#5d1c2e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5d1c2e is composed of 36.5% red, 11%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.9% magenta, 50.5% yellow and 63.5% black. It has a hue angle of 343.4 degrees, a saturation of 53.7% and a lightness of 23.7%. #5d1c2e color hex could be obtained by blending #ba385c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#5d1c2e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fbf2f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#5d1c2e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#41383a is the less saturated color, while #790022 is the most saturated one.
